<br /> <br />Education <br />B.S. in Civil Hydrologist Engineer <br />Alma- Ata, former USSR 1987 <br /> <br />Professional Registrations <br />• Professional Surveyor and <br />Mapper License in the State of <br />Florida, LS6765 <br /> <br />Field of Specialization <br />• Field Data Collection <br />• AutoCAD / Land Desktop <br />• Total Station and Data <br />Collector Knowledge <br />• Topographic Surveys <br />• Roadway Surveys <br />• Certificate of Elevations <br />• GPS Field Location <br />• Surveys with NAVD88 and <br />NGVD29 <br />• As-Built Certified Surveys for <br />Water and Sewer projects <br />• Project Stakeout <br />• Writing and interpretations of <br />legal descriptions <br /> <br />Years of Experience <br />39 years <br /> <br /> <br /> <br /> <br /> <br /> <br /> <br />FERNANDO FERNANDEZ, P.S.M. <br />Chief Surveyor <br /> <br />Experience Summary <br />Mr. Fernandez has over 39 years of field data verification, <br />collection and surveying experience. Mr. Fernandez is a <br />professional proficient in the use of different kinds of Data <br />Collectors, Total Station and other surveying equipment, and is <br />familiar with the process of developing Topographic Surveys and <br />As-Built Drawings Miami-Dade County and Broward County, <br />conducting surveys of above ground features and utility <br />verifications, roadway surveys, construction stake-out and utility <br />project as-builts. Mr. Fernandez is a diligent worker with <br />knowledge of AutoCAD and various tools of trade. He can <br />manage multiple tasks, work on projects autonomously, and work <br />as required to meet deadlines. Mr. Fernandez has recently <br />developed as-builts for water and sewer connections, conducted <br />multiple Right-Of-Way surveys for Transit Improvements and is <br />familiar with the department’s requirements for Topographic <br />surveys. Mr. Fernandez is a Florida Registered Land Surveyor and <br />participates personally in field data collection of all assignments <br />under his control, qualifying him as a surveyor with extensive field <br />knowledge and experience. <br /> <br />Relevant Experience <br />E20-WASD -01B General Land and Engineering Surveying and <br />Mapping Services, Miami-Dade County, FL. <br />This project consists of providing land surveying and Subsurface <br />Utility Engineering (SUE) services for water and wastewater <br />projects identified in WASD's Capital Improvement Plan (CIP). <br />• WO1 - Sunny Isles Boulevard & Collins Avenue. Mr. Fernandez <br />serves as the Survey Lead for this project, overseeing the <br />Subsurface Utility Engineering (SUE) efforts requested by <br />Miami-Dade Water and Sewer (WASD) at the intersection of <br />Sunny Isles Boulevard and Collins Avenue. His responsibilities <br />focus on directing and performing up to ten soft digs, <br />verifying underground utility locations, documenting field <br />conditions, and ensuring all investigations comply with FDOT <br />standards for these state-maintained roadways. <br />• WO2 - Carol City Facility Survey. Mr. Fernandez serves as the <br />Survey Lead for this project, overseeing all land surveying <br />activities required to support the Miami-Dade Water and <br />Sewer Department (WASD) at the Carol City Facility. His <br />responsibilities include directing field crews in the full survey <br />of the 16-acre property covering the canal, pond, and all <br />internal features, as well as managing approximately 3,500 <br />linear feet of ROW-to-ROW survey along surrounding <br />roadways. He ensures accurate data collection, adherence to <br />county and municipal standards, and the successful delivery <br />of comprehensive survey documentation for WASD. <br /> <br />38
